Between 2013 and 2023, the share of pregnant women receiving prenatal care in Nigeria increased from 60.6% to 69.6%. This represents a positive trend, with data showing continuous growth each year. Notably, we observe an average annual growth of around 4.5% over the past decade. Over the last two years, the year-on-year variation was 1.4% in 2022, rising slightly to 1.2% in 2023. The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) for the past five years stands at 0.59%.
From 2024 onwards, forecasts suggest the upward trend will continue, projecting the share to reach 72.2% by 2028, reflecting a forecasted 5-year growth rate of 3%.
